During these difficult times, my students have been affected tremendously due to the closure of our school. Currently, we are adapting to distance learning by using platforms such as Google Classroom and SeeSaw. My students are using these platforms so that they can access their work while at home during the hours that their parents can help them. Parents are trying to help them when they can but are also struggling. I am trying to teach my students on the limited resources that I have at home

Many students rely on us educators for so much. However, this has been taken away from students. We are now asking them to learn new material with out being in the classroom. Teachers are trying to present material on their computers. They are making new things because they don't have electronic versions of work for students.
A document camera and iPad are important tools for effectively teaching from home.
It is difficult when I am teaching something and I can not share it on my screen. I have tried writing things on a piece of paper or small white board, but it is difficult for the students to see. This is where a document camera will make a huge difference. I will be able to show things such as their My Math book, Texts for Close Reading materials, etc. The students will be able to see what I am doing. An iPad will help me scan documents and then upload them to my google classroom as images. This will help me share things that I don’t have electronic copies of with my students.
A document camera will help everyone, especially my visual learners. Not everyone is able to follow along or understand a concept orally. The document camera will be my students' eyes so they can see what I am modeling and teaching.
